Merchandising Assistant | £28,000 - £32,000 | 2 days on-site | 3 days WFH | Manchester City Centre
You'll be working directly with the Merch Manager in a brand that's growing quickly, so there's loads of opportunity to learn, get stuck in, and have a real impact. It's a collaborative, no-nonsense environment where good ideas and proactive thinking go a long way.We're looking for a Senior Merchandising Assistant / Assistant Merchandiser to join the team. This is a hands-on role in a fast-growing, e-commerce-led brand where you'll play a key part in keeping product flowing, trading smoothly, and stock in the right place at the right time.
What you'll be doing:
- Pull together weekly, monthly and seasonal trading reports
- Dig into sales and stock data to spot trends, risks and opportunities
- Call out what's working (and what's not), and suggest actions
- Support range planning, assortment reviews and OTB
- Keep reporting clean, efficient and constantly improving
- Manage price updates on site (markdowns, promos, etc.)
- Own stock intake and keep a close eye on availability day-to-day
- Manage the intake schedule, working with suppliers to track orders and deliveries
- Stay on top of any delays or issues and help solve them early
- Work closely with the warehouse to make sure receipts and despatches hit deadlines
- Keep the critical path updated and moving
- Act as the link between Merch, Buying, Marketing, Trading and Warehouse
- Share clear updates on stock levels, deliveries, issues and actions
- Keep everyone aligned so launches and trading run smoothly
Essentials
- Experience in merchandising, stock control or a similar commercial role (around 6 -12 months)
- Confident with Excel (think Pivot Tables, XLOOKUP, formulas, etc.)
- Strong organisation and communication skills
- Solid understanding of the critical path from order to launch
- Comfortable working with stock KPIs (availability, OOS, missed sales)
- Good commercial awareness, especially in an e-commerce environment
- Detail-oriented, proactive, and happy juggling multiple moving parts
- Experience with FOB suppliers and freight processes
- Understanding of production, shipping or supplier challenges
- Knowledge of size curves, pack ratios and trading patterns
- Shopify experience
- Exposure to wholesale or partnerships
- Broader interest in trading and planning
